In a historic move, the United Nations General Assembly has adopted a resolution declaring the slave trade in Africa as 'the most heinous crime against humanity.' This resolution opens the door for apologies and reparations for centuries of slavery, despite opposition from three countries and abstention from 52 others.

President Donald Trump has ordered the reinstatement of the Christopher Columbus statue in the White House garden, sparking political and cultural debate over the legacy of this explorer. The statue is a replica of a monument that was demolished during protests following George Floyd's death in 2020.
